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Dr Geoffrey Lee Singer is enrolled with medicare and thus, if eligible, can prescribe medicare part D drugs to patients with medicare part D benefits.

Roundup: Rx discounts for Medicaid programs are increasing; deadline extended for Mich. Medigap verifications

Governors have complained repeatedly in recent months that spiraling Medicaid costs are crushing their budgets. But there's good news on at least one line item in the $370 billion program — prescription drug discounts are getting more generous. According to a new report from the Inspector General of the U.S. Health and Human Services Department, discounts under the federal-state Medicaid program have been growing since 2006, adding up to a 45 percent rebate for most brand name drugs by 2009.
